A batch of Covid-19 vaccines, including 1,209,400 doses of AstraZeneca, was officially handed over to the Ministry of Health (MoH) by Vietnam Vaccine Joint Stock Company (VNVC) on the morning of August 22. This is the ninth batch of vaccines brought to Vietnam by VNVC on August 19, under the pre-order contract of 30 million doses between VNVC and AstraZeneca.
